MTH 5007

Introduction to Optimization

Florida Institute of Technology · UGRD · Fall 2026

1 section
Add to a schedule

Catalog description

An applied treatment of modeling, analysis and solution of deterministic (e.g., nonprobabilistic) problems. Topics include model formulation, linear programming, network flow, discrete optimization and dynamic programming. Recommended: At least one upper-level undergraduate math course.
